Shatush is the coloring of hair, the technique is performed by combining shades that are very similar to each other in color.

For this purpose, natural shades are used to create a visual feeling as if they were burnt out in the sun, thereby achieving a stylish result and committing some kind of optical illusion.

This method is perfect for women who want to quickly and without drastic changes in hairstyles, to update their appearance and make new adjustments to it. Properly executed Shatush technique will leave unnoticed the master's intervention process.

Types and technology of coloring

The main types of coloring Shatush that are suitable for red and red hair are: classical dyeing with a pile and more complex without a pile.

For To make a classic Shatush with a pile, you need the following:

  1. To divide all the hair into small strands, it is important that they are thin and practically do not differ from one another. Then each of them must be combed.
  2. Step back a few centimeters from the roots and apply a brightening ingredient to the surface. The paint should be stretched from top to bottom, thereby making a smooth and invisible transition. For a more pronounced color, you need to do less bouffant, so that the paint spreads better and dyes most of the strands.
  3. After you put the paint, you need to endure a certain time, which is indicated on the package, then rinse.
  4. The final stage is the toning, which gives a more saturated color. The tinting agent is applied to the hair and washed off after the specified time. In some cases, this item can be avoided, it all depends on the wishes and on how you are satisfied with the original color.

In order to make Shatush without a pile, it is recommended to contact the master, since the paint is applied to smaller strands and requires accuracy. Thus, you can provide a less noticeable transition and create a pronounced tonality.

What is the difference between coloring hair from ombre, highlighting and balayazh - what is the difference

The technique of stretching colors is what distinguishes shatush from highlighting in a qualitative way, although some strands are present in both versions.
There are differences when compared with balambaz and ombra.

Sometimes in the final result, the shatush is very much like an ombre or balazhezh, but still there are some differences.

For example, ombre is a fairly clear transition of colors from the roots to the tips. And for coloring used several shades. The tips are brightened completely, but the gradient transition is clearly visible, which does not add naturalness. In this case, the paint is applied almost from the middle.

Balayazh is like a shatush, but there are large strands painted in it, and in the shatush they are small. In addition, soft and gentle formulations are used in balayazh for dyeing.

It is important to know! Shatush and balayazh can be done at home, ombre staining is too complicated for self-fulfillment.

Shatush is the chaotic coloring of strands of hair with a combination of pigments of the same color.. This technique creates the effect of texturing and natural burning of the strands in the sun. It looks especially impressive on brunettes, brown-haired women and owners of wheat blonde.

Shatush on natural red hair has certain difficulties in the implementation of ideas and the choice of colorants, as copper hair almost never fade in the sun and is difficult to lighten due to the great durability of red pigment. Therefore, in order not to get an unpredictable result, it is better to give your curls into the hands of a professional colorist, who already had experience in the implementation of shatush technology on redheads.

For dyeing shatush, sparing, most often ammonia-free dyes are used. Some manufacturers claim that their products contain only components of plant origin - extracts from plants and herbs. The root zone is not affected during the procedure, which results in a rich play of colors and a smooth transition from natural copper to more highlighted strands.

This technique looks advantageous on the hair of any length, except for very short, as on the curls less than 5 cm of the shatush will look unnatural and bright.

Application after recent staining

Shatush on the hair, I painted a bright fiery red or red color - it is bright, stylish and attractive. With this technique, you can create a bold and informal image.

But, Before choosing a shade for coloring, it is worth considering a few nuances:

  1. If the hair was previously lightened and dyed red - shatush can give a somewhat uneven and sloppy color, as the pigments of red and red tend to accumulate and very poorly washed out of the rod.
  2. If the hair was colored with henna - shatush can give an unpredictable color, up to shades of green. Therefore, before painting with chemical pigments, no less than 2 months should pass from the moment of henna staining.
  3. Growing black roots can spoil the overall appearance of hair, making it sloppy.
  4. Shatush on ammonium-dyed hair can give the hairstyle an even more painful and depleted appearance and create the illusion of completely dehydrated hair, which does not hold pigment.

Ideally, the master tone and shatush should be done by one master, carefully selecting the shades of dyes. Plus, at least once a month you need to visit the salon in order to tint the regrown roots. Maintaining such a hairstyle in a decent way is an expensive pleasure.. Make the same beautiful shatush at home on the hair, painted in red, is almost impossible.

Shatush is a very popular hair coloring technology today. Its meaning is in a smooth transition from darker shades to light ones. The result is the effect of slightly sun-touched hair. Technology takes its name from the English word "shahtoosh" - which means expensive kind of wool. She invented the Italian hairdresser Aldo Coppola.

To suit: The Shatush technology is universal and will suit almost everyone. The only thing worth considering is that such a gradient will look most advantageous on more or less long hair. So the effect will be very visual and the glare will play like on your hair. Also best of all shatush looks on brown-haired women and brunettes. Master blondes are advised to use no more than two shades when coloring the shatush. Shatush gives brightness, brilliance and expressiveness to hair and their owner (at least, so they promise.).

Who is not suitable: This technology is not suitable for hair that has been damaged by a perm or has been dyed with henna.

Many confused shatush and highlighting. What is the difference between them? In the case of staining technology shatush - used color stretching technique and coloring is done outdoors. How staining occurs:

- dyeing is done on dry hair,

- the master divides the hair into strands of 2 cm,

- coloring begins with the lower strands to the upper. The top is clamped at the top of the clips,

- before dyeing, the strands are well combed and the dyeing composition is applied with short strokes of the brush edge. In this case, the roots are not painted,

- holding period - from 10 to 30 minutes. My hair was kept for 30 minutes,

- then there is a flushing of the paint with running water,

- for neutralization of the clarifier and acquisition of smoothness - hair is additionally tinted.

Features and benefits

Shatush is one of the varieties of gentle highlighting, because it suits beauties with fiery curls. The fact is that the structure of the hair of these girls is quite porous and fragile, aggressive ammonia dyes can damage it even more. During partial dyeing, only 40-60% of the hair is processed. In addition, the technique does not involve the use of foil and thermal paper, which reduces the negative impact. You can get an updated image without harm to the hair.

  • achieving the effect of natural burnout curls in the sun,
  • smooth and invisible transitions
  • the technique helps to visually increase the density of the hair,
  • growing roots are imperceptible, painting will have to be renewed every 3-4 months,
  • the ability to hide gray hair, provided that it is not more than 30%,
  • the presence of several types of methods.

Technology

Shatush in red tones or other scale is not so simple. The technique is quite complicated, as it involves the gradual stretching of the color. From the roots, indentation is made, the order is combed or remains flat, depending on the chosen technique.

The bouffant helps to make the transition almost imperceptible to prying eyes, but if staining is done on smooth curls, the contrast will be more pronounced. At the very top, the shade is as close to natural as possible, and to the tips it becomes lighter.

Stylists recommend using a range of 2-3 tones lighter than the base. This will create a natural and attractive play in the curls. Red play

Red color can be not only a great base, it is organically woven into light brown and dark curls. Note that the choice of tone should match your color type. The most spectacular solar play looks at women of the "spring" and "autumn" type.

  1. "Spring" is distinguished by an even white skin tone, sometimes with a peach shade, eyes of all shades of blue and green. She will be impressed with golden, honey and wheat shades.
  2. In the "autumn" pale, devoid of blush, or light beige skin with a peach shimmer, often covered with freckles, eyes are brown, topazovye, green or green-blue. A warm gamut of golden, honey, copper and red shades will be the best choice for such women.
  3. Brunettes and brown-haired “winter” type are distinguished by porcelain whiteness of their skin, they have blue, brown, violet or emerald eyes. Coloring is recommended to carry restrained shades, such as dark copper, light walnut, coffee with milk, milk chocolate and dark chocolate.
  4. "Summer" ladies with pale thin skin and whites of the color of milk are not the best candidates for the fire shatusha. They are more suitable for cold shades that are as close as possible to the tone of the base: platinum, copper, and light blond.

1 The difference between shatush and dyeing techniques, ombre, balayazha

Unprofessional view is difficult to assess the difference between these similar technicians. All of them are used to give natural, as natural hair tone as possible with a beautiful burning effect in the sun. In each of them, the end result is the contrast of dark roots and light tips.

  • Shatush elegance and its difference from the traditional highlightingincluding Californian highlighting, is the technology of stretching the paint, which uses a hairdresser.
  • From the staining method ombre Shatush differs in its chaos and lack of noticeable graduation.
  • Balayazh - this is the golden mean between the two previous techniques: there are also contrasting tips of the hair, but the painting will be done vertically, and the lower part stands out more dramatically.

8 Coloring shatush at home

If you decide to paint yourself or with the help of a friend at home, choose a bouffant technique. Get a dye or powder, followed by toning the paint without ammonia. A few weeks before painting, try to give your hair increased attention and care: firming masks, detergents with keratin, and do not wash your hair for 3-4 days to protect the hair and better staining.

  1. Dilute the dye according to the instructions.
  2. Divide the hair strands into four parts - at the temples, on the crown and the back of the head, fasten with hairpins or clips.
  3. Now, from each beam, select strands of 2 centimeters. Depart from the roots - about 7−10 centimeters - and from this distance to the tips, mix your hair with a comb.
  4. Dye (or powder) should be applied to the combed hair with sharp strokes. Then they need to be shaded with a brush or fingers in a glove.
  5. Soak the dye on the hair for the period specified in the instructions, but try to look closely at the degree of clarification.
  6. If you worked with powder, it's time to start toning.
  7. After the time has elapsed, wash the dye off the hair, rinse it with shampoo and soften the hair with a balm.

Doing shatush on red hair

Before you start coloring the curls, check out recommendations of the trichologist:

  • Do not wash your hair for 2-3 days before the procedure. The fatty film, which is formed on the strands over this period of time, will reduce the aggressive effect of the components of the coloring composition.
  • Test for an allergic reaction. To do this, apply a little paint on the inside of the forearm and wait 15 minutes, then rinse. If the skin is reddened and itchy, then you should stop using the staining procedure.
  • Start using nutritional masks and conditioners 10-15 days before staining. This will help to saturate the hair with useful substances and elements that will strengthen the structure of the curls. Also, do not get involved in laying and drying strands with thermal devices during this period, it is best to completely abandon their use.
